Use unity to build highquality 3d and 2d games, deploy them across mobile, desktop, vrar, consoles or the web, and connect with loyal and enthusiastic players and customers. How to get smooth camera orbit movement in unity tutorial. I have watched many tutorials including the unity official tutorials about moving an object. Unity shader graph build your shaders visually with unity. I would like to move my player from one position to another position using key detection. In this course, were going to create the building blocks needed to make. How to create a 2d platformer for android in unity part one. Unet unity 5 networking entity interpolation part 1 of 6. Youll start with the most basic kind of mesh manipulation. Oct 02, 2019 with that out the way, youre ready to discover the unity api by making a simple game.
A uv mask inverted then multiplied against itself to create a smooth gradient across the yaxis. Set up an fps controller character in unity gamedev academy. The best place to ask and answer questions about development with unity. Click download project open project to automatically open it in unity.
Rather than spend forever trying to fix this problem, i reworked my engine a little and changed the way the player moves he now doesnt move on the x axis. Download the materials for the project using the download materials button at the top or bottom of this tutorial, unzip it somewhere and open the starter project inside unity. To help users navigate the site we have posted a site navigation guide if you are a new user to unity answers, check out our faq for more information. Introduction to multiplayer games with unity and photon. Take a look at the folder structure in the project window. Unity is committed to supporting our community of creators during this challenging time. It contains images and other assets that well be using in this tutorial. Unet unity 5 networking entity interpolation part 1 of 6 break into components. Download dotween and unzip it anywhere in your unity assets folder just not inside the editor, plugins or resources directories.
Mar, 2019 in the next post, we will look at the design limitations imposed by the 16bit era as well as the unity work needed to get that truly old tv feel. How to do the smooth moves dance in real life fortnite. Id recommend the tutorial video on the attack animation for a. Download dotween and unzip it anywhere in your unity assets folder just not inside the editor, plugins or resources directories setup. Feb 26, 20 in this video you will learn how to use the 2d collidergen package with smoothmoves by echo17. Getting started with unitys 2d animation package unity blog. The most basic approach is, as stated in the link in the comments, to multiply your movement with ltatime in the updatemethod of your gameobject ltatime is the time passed between the last frame update and the current. Having the camera follow the player character is a common requirement for many types of games, so i thought id share a helpful trick to ensure the camera follows the player smoothly and fluidly the basic premise of having a camera follow the player is to update the cameras position each frame to match that of the players. How to do the smooth moves dance in real life fortnite dance tutorial no. For some reason your suggested change could not be submitted. The fps microgame template is a 3d first person shooter game that you can mod and customize. Shader graph opens up the field for artists and other team members by making it easy to create shaders. My name is jesse freeman, and welcome to my advanced unity 2d platformer player movement course. To get the most out of unity, you will need to have an uptodate internet connection with at least 4mbps download and 1 mbps upload.
It moves up and down vertically but for some players that. Unity animator tutorial comprehensive guide gamedev academy. Borrowing from all the code in the physics tutorial series, it was actually a very smooth process. Dotween is the evolution of hotween, a unity tween engine. Smooth moves is pretty good but it sure isnt the standard. Easy tutorial for virtual joystick in unity with example. Page 1 of 2 courseforge video tutorials posted in tutorials. Smooth moves produces a skinned mesh with an animation component that unity controls. Moving a vertex should have some influence on the vertices around it to maintain a smooth shape. Explore worldbuilding in 2d in this beginner tutorial on unity learn. I would like to know how i can make the player movement smooth. Jun 17, 2016 how to get smooth camera orbit movement in unity tutorial. Ensure you launch the project using unity version 2018. In the game, the player object spaceship moves upwards continuously and then the player can use either left or right to move the player to avoid obstacles.
Fantastic ui, great feature set and it is a standalone app so it isnt stuck being confined to unitys ui. Im using smooth moves in unity, and it definitely speeds up my animation production. Smooth moves stores all the texture information as asset database guids. Complete all the steps in the following unity tutorial. Ndcf will enable you to create your own playable courses for jack nicklaus perfectgolf which you will be able to share with anyone who plays the game.
This was a short tutorial because adding moving platforms is not a big challenge, especially if you know the physics system well. Here is a unity video tutorial in which i show how i implemented a smooth. This is more of a unity issue, than a smooth moves one, but i was asked about how to move animations between projects, so i thought id post a copy of my reply here. Get three months of complimentary access to unity learn premium, and join create with code live, a virtual course for students, teachers, or anyone interested in learning to code. And you can already use these things in your projects. Smoothmoves is one of the only packages that fully support bone. Playmaker takes a higher level approach, offering an intuitive structure with states, actions and events to quickly build behaviors. Id recommend the tutorial video on the attack animation for a good example of this. Smooth moves assumes that all the animation set up is done within its own editor and then uses that information to regenerate the skinned mesh. Playmaker has been used in dozens of shipped products including hearthstone, inside, hollow. Smooth moves 2d skeletal animation page 11 unity forum.
You can use shader to do sharp blending on terrain textures like this old version custom terrain sharp blending shader, but can also set alphamap texture filtermode. My character movement doesnt feel smooth unity related. It can be used with the high definition render pipeline and. Unity is a modern, cloudbased platform that relies a lot more on your internet connection than the conveyancer did. You can learn more about the different movement types in the blog entry. The steps you need to follow vary, depending on the version of unity you are using. Unity 2d, spine, and 2d toolkit are probably your best bets out of the 9 options. Smooth moves 2d skeletal animation page 2 unity forum. Recent additions to the unity workflows have made it a wellsuited environment for creating your retro games. The smooth mode is used to even out transitions between all bone. Courseforge video tutorials tutorials perfect parallel. Parallax scrolling is a simple and effective way to create the illusion of depth in a 2d game. Unity move object with lerp you can use lerp function to move an object automatically.
If the unity editor is already open, click file new project instead. You can assign start point and end point manually in script or with mouse click. Unity is free, easy to learn, has excellent documentation, and is the game engine used for building games. For these unity versions, the plugin is shipped as a unity package in the. Unity is very friendly regarding using asset packages. In this video you will learn how to use the 2d collidergen package with smoothmoves by echo17.
This tutorial has been requested a few times, so i hope you find it useful. Keep in mind that smooth moves has the ability to modify animation curves in its own editor, so you can tweak your easing and tangents there, just like you would in the animation editor in unity. Rotate any gameobject smoothly without any animation tutorial. You also might need to update your computer systems to get the most out of unity. Simply connect nodes in a graph network and you can see your changes instantly. This would remove any settings that you applied via the animation editor built into unity. Jan 01, 2020 okay, so we want to make a first person shooter game, and there is one important thing to do. Unity alters its mesh to go around the table, and through the collider you are able to place a virtual cup upon the table. Like previous installments in the franchise, smooth moves is a collection of microgames that the player accesses through a fastpaced series of story chapters. May 20, 2016 a complete tutorial explaining how to create a very basic 2d platform game for android with touchscreen controls in unity.
The 2d tilemap system has been made even better and now supports grid, hex, and isometric tilemaps. After importing a new dotween update, you have to setup dotween in order to importreimport additional libraries based on your unity version. As a newbie i am finding it very difficult to achieve a very smooth motion in the player movement. No more than 1015 minutes will be needed to complete this tutorial.
If i start the level with either one selected, it moves as predicted, sliding. Using unity indie, modified directional hard light shadows. Whether youre developing a vertical shooter or a horizontal side scrolling platformer, parallax scrolling is a tried and true staple of gaming that will greatly increase the immersion and graphical impact of your project. Complete the creative mods to build on the project and make it more your own, while learning the basics of unity.
We are going to build, from scratch, a character that moves similar to this. The 2d pixel perfect guide for 16 bits retro visuals is now available here. As an example, lets presume unitys surfaceobserver has just recognized your dining room table. Get three months of complimentary access to unity learn premium, and join create with code live, a virtual course for students, teachers, or. Smooth moves is not really meant to have a lot of animations on screen at once anyway since unity wont batch skinned meshes. Since i did not write the animation from scratch, i cannot change the way unity starts and stops the looping. So, some people from around the world, they use the asset store for unity, and they build things that you cant simply purchase or download for free depending on whats available out there. Having the camera follow the player character is a common requirement for many types of games, so i thought id share a helpful trick to ensure the camera follows the player smoothly and fluidly. Beginners guide to simple virtual joystick in unity. This actually empowers nonprogrammers to create without having to become programmers themselves. The scripts for this lesson can be downloaded here. Contribute to prime31touchkit development by creating an account on github.
Skeletal animation looks different to hand drawn animation though, so whether skeletal animation works depends on your game design and how you want the art to look in motion. To help users navigate the site we have posted a site navigation guide if you are a new user to unity answers, check out our faq for more information make sure to check out our knowledge base for commonly asked unity questions if you are a moderator, see our. After reading this tutorial, and if you carefully follow the explanation, you will be able to make 3d textured models like the squirrel and publish them on the web. Authoring shaders in unity has traditionally been the realm of people with some programming ability. This project will incorporate a number of key topics including how to make cutscenes, how to quickly build and prototype a 2d level, and how to precisely. The smooth movement test application lets you play around with different settings. The illusion of forward movement is created by the scrolling background, which is now super smooth using just transform. First of all, thank you all for testing the smoothie3d modelling solution.
Download the desert island scene sample project to start experimenting and interacting with the shaders yourself. Additionally, you can use the new pixel perfect camera component to achieve consistent pixel. This project contains everything you need to get started with shader graph. Although we cannot accept all submissions, we do read each suggested change from our users and will make updates where applicable. The basic premise of having a camera follow the player is to update the cameras position each frame to match that of the players. Thank you for helping us improve the quality of unity documentation. Jun 19, 2019 once you have everything set up, download the starter project using the download materials link at the top or bottom or this tutorial, and open photon starter with unity. By the end of part one you will have a working apk that lets you control.
I created smooth moves out of frustration at all the hoops i had to jump through. I was hooked the moment i saw the workflow in your tutorials. Make games, vr, ar, and other interactive content in unity without writing code. Smooth moves 2d skeletal animation page 7 unity forum. It adds walking and running, sliding down slopes both those above the slope limit andor specific tagged objects, air control, antibunny hopping, the ability to check fall distances, and special antibump code that eliminates that irritating bumpity bumpity bumpa bump you get. If you dont have it, then you can download it from the internet. This is glauco pires, for mammoth interactive, and welcome to the first person shooter tutorial in unity. Introduction nicklaus design courseforge is an extensive golf course design software suite plugin for the unity editor. Unity learn provides awardwinning free tutorials, sample projects, and full courses for mastering realtime 3d development skills with unity learn to make video games, vr, ar, and more. How to build a complete 2d platformer in unity gamedev academy. Smooth moves is a totally different system that does boned animation vs sprite animation like unitys tools.
181 229 113 1444 660 138 1222 786 547 1575 312 1255 1574 805 1650 1252 1086 1520 557 360 1417 614 810 120 1178 279 474 1042 827 642 10 1285 244 276